Parking Eye Mecca Bingo

Grateful for any support with this.

My partner visited Mecca Bingo in Oldham August 2021. The car park is free for Mecca Bingo customers. My partner advises she was told on the door someone would come round during the bingo to take her reg plate, which didn’t happen. My partner advises she forgot to do whilst she was in there.

She then received a parking ticket from parking eye which she ignored along with all subsequent letters and has now received a county court judgment letter, we appealed this but Parking Eye rejected this and have suggested mediation. 

We rung Mecca Bingo who have said they have never collected reg plates manually and that there is a machine in the hall where you key in your reg plate. The manager has said if it was sooner he could of contacted parking eye who usually drop the parking ticket at that stage.

    The court letter was a court claim , not a CCJ , J meaning judgment , not happened yet

    You cannot appeal a court claim N1 form , so the defendant must have submitted a defence , let us see a copy of the defence and when was it submitted ?

    Up to now she ( as victim and as defendant ) has gone about this all wrong , ( ignoring the letters was extremely foolish and is why PE issued a court claim ) the keypad inside the venue is typical of many clubs , pubs and restaurants , rarely would anyone come round taking VRM details

    Tell her to login to MCOL , check the claim history and copy it below too , it's only a few lines

    Also show us pictures of the signage

    Plan A would have worked , if done at the time ( the manager was correct )
